5. Rabbit Paradise in ÅŒkunoshima, Japan If you're a rabbit lover, you just need to see Okunoshima, Japan. A real rabbit paradise, Okunoshima is an island the place rabbits are as plentiful as pigeons. Hunting and dogs are illegal here.

7. Relax with camels on the Pushkar Camel Fair Check out the Pushkar Camel Fair, held every November in Pushkar, India. Yearly over 11,000 camels, horses and cattle appear to benefit from the festival. Camels are adorned with gorgeous camel clothes, hoping to win the annual camel beauty contest.
